These rankings can be used to compare panels. Try to prevent a panel with high STC or factory-rating, yet a low NOCT or everyday score, about an additional panel. as detailed by the manufacturer, e (https://www.startus.cc/company/solar-kit-outlet).g. 250 watt solar panel can generating maximum 250 watt constantly under ideal Common Examination Conditions


STC irradiance at 1000 W per square meter, cell temperature at 77F (25C), air mass AM 1.5. according to PVUSA examination problems, e.g. a 250 watt STC component may create optimal 225 watts in PTC real-world conditions. PTC Peak Watts are the REAL-WORLD rated MAXIMUM DC power produced under PVUSA Examination Problems for sunlight and temperature.


according to daily problems, e.g. a 250 watt STC component might generate 195 watts in NOCT problems. Nominal Watts are the AVERAGE constant DC power created in day-to-day problems for sunshine and temperature. NOCT irradiance at 800 W per square meter, ambient temperature at 68F (20C), solar cell temperature at 113F (45C), wind speed 2 mph.

A higher % is much better, however make sure to stabilize that with the expense of the panel. A lot of standard photovoltaic panels have performance from 14% to 20%. Some higher performance panels can be dual the cost of average efficiency panels. You might conserve a great deal of cash merely by adding one extra panel with ordinary effectiveness to achieve the same outcome.

For grid-connected systems, the first consideration is to figure out if you desire a main string inverter, a string inverter with module optimizers, or a micro-inverter system. String inverters usually cost 10% to 20% less than optimizer or micro-inverter systems. They have a 15 to twenty years anticipated performance life. String inverter warranties normally cover ten years, and a lot of makers offer optional extensive service warranties as much as twenty years.


This implies that each solar panel can run individually of the panels around it. Optimizer and Micro-inverter systems normally set you back 10% to 20% more and call for extra cable televisions and hardware, yet they can generate even more power, particularly in shaded problems - solar panels. Research studies reveal that with full, direct sunshine, a micro-inverter system might produce 2% to 3% even more power than a string inverter system


They usually have 25 year warranties and a longer efficiency lifetime. Optimizers and Micro-inverters are wonderful for easy system growth, and they function better in areas that have shielding or various roof surface areas. Solar panels can be also tilt-mounted on flat roofings utilizing attachments or non-penetrating ballast trays for all sorts of flat roofing system surface areas. There are a couple of variations of ground-mounted photovoltaic panels. The most usual is a multi-pole ground install using several concrete piers and 2" or 3" galvanized steel articles.
